The Double-Triple Sensation

Mitch Voit, a 21-year-old rising star, has achieved a remarkable feat in a recent High-A game. He secured three hits and stole three bases, a performance reminiscent of a basketball triple-double. This 'double-triple' is a testament to Voit's all-around prowess, showcasing his ability to contribute both offensively and defensively. What makes this particularly intriguing is the rarity of such a feat. It's not every day you see a player dominate in multiple facets of the game.

Personally, I find Voit's story captivating. As a first-round pick from Michigan, he's already making waves with his speed and power. His .248/.358/.414 slash line and 11 homers are impressive, but it's his stolen bases that truly set him apart. With 34 steals, he leads his team and ranks second in the South Atlantic League. This combination of speed and power is a rare commodity in baseball, and it's exciting to witness its emergence at such a young age.

The Highs and Lows of the Minors

The High-A game between Hudson Valley and Brooklyn showcased the brilliance of Mitch Voit, but it also featured other notable performances. John Bay, a 25-year-old outfielder, is on a hot streak, going 10-for-32 in his last eight games. This kind of consistency is crucial for players looking to make the jump to the next level. Meanwhile, in the Low-A game, St. Lucie's Randy Guzman hit his 10th homer, leading the team in that category. It's these individual achievements that keep the minor league circuit buzzing.
